They do have a very strict policy, and it was stated above by CharlyFoxtrot but here it is again:
"When changing your password, your new Apple ID password should:
Be at least eight characters. Contain at least one number (0-9). Contain at least one uppercase letter (A-Z). Contain at least one lowercase letter (a-z). Not contain three consecutive identical characters. Not have been used in the past year. Not be the same as your Apple ID username."
it was never this strict though, but this is at least a few a years old.
